Role Responsibilities
  • Assess and monitor physical, emotional, and psychological needs of patients
  • Create hospice care plans aligned with patient wishes and goals
  • Administer medications, treatments, and interventions
  • Manage pain and symptoms effectively
  • Educate and support patients' families and caregivers
  • Collaborate with interdisciplinary team members
  • Maintain accurate and timely documentation
  • Participate in on-call rotations as required

Qualifications
  • Graduate of an accredited nursing school with current licensure in the state of operation
  • Minimum one year of nursing experience; 3+ years preferred
  • Experience in hospice or similar setting preferred
  • Knowledge of hospice philosophy of care
  • Commitment to clinical and documentation excellence
  • Valid driver's license with insured, well-maintained vehicle
